The General’s Daughter

As a film, “The General’s Daughter” is as conflicted as its characters.

At first glance, the film looks like another one of those John Grisham Southern thrillers. It’s images are soaked in a golden honey hue, and you can literally feel the humidity and smell the sweat that permeates each and every scene. Read the rest of this entry »
